Description of Primary Duties
The Missouri State University Department of Finance, Economics and Risk Management anticipates a January 2027 or August 2027 opening for a non-tenure-track position as a Clinical Assistant Professor of Financial Planning.
Primary duties include teaching undergraduate and graduate courses in our financial planning program, such as introduction to financial planning and estate planning; providing administrative support to the CFP Board Registered Financial Planning Program; developing and maintaining relationships with employers in the financial planning industry; supporting experiential learning opportunities for students; and contributing service to Missouri State University, the profession, and the broader community. The successful candidate may serve as Director of the CFP Board Registered Financial Planning Program and as faculty advisor for the FPA Student Association and BEAR Essentials.

Additional Qualifications
Minimum acceptable qualifications include: 1) a master's degree in business administration, finance, financial planning, or a closely related field, and 2) the Certified Financial Planner designation (CFP certification) or the ability to successfully obtain the CFP designation in one year from the hire date. The candidate must also have a minimum of five years of experience in financial planning or in a field that supports the financial planning process, such as estate planning or insurance.
